US News and World Report regularly ranks UMBC in the top 10 of most … WebPhysician Assistants (PA) are highly skilled health care professionals educated in the medical model who practice medicine. PAs graduate from a Baccalaureate or Master’s Degree program that may be affiliated with a medical school. PAs practice medicine under the supervision of a licensed physician within a patient-centred health care team. WebPhysician associate training usually lasts two years, with students studying for 46-48 weeks each year and involves many aspects of an undergraduate or postgraduate medical degree. The training focuses principally on general adult medicine in hospital and general practice, rather than specialty care. There will also be 1,600 hours of clinical ... WebA bachelor’s degree from an accredited program in the United States. A minimum cumulative grade point average of 2.8 or higher. Prerequisites in biology, chemistry, psychology, statistics or biostatistics, and medical terminology. Practical experience and work in jobs like emergency medical technician, lab assistant, medical assistant ...
